エージェントのガバナンス・評価

自律型AIの信頼性を担保するAgentOps実践アプローチ:ガバナンス・評価ツール比較と導入検討ガイド

この記事は急速に進化する技術について解説しています。最新情報は公式ドキュメントをご確認ください。

約17分で読めます
文字サイズ:
自律型AIの信頼性を担保するAgentOps実践アプローチ:ガバナンス・評価ツール比較と導入検討ガイド
目次

この記事の要点

  • 自律型AIの「暴走」を防ぐためのガバナンス戦略と多角的な評価基準
  • DeepEvalやLLM-as-a-Judgeを活用した自動評価パイプラインの構築と実践アプローチ
  • AIエージェントが引き起こす法的リスク(責任の所在、PL法など)と防衛策

AIエージェントの社会実装を阻む「ブラックボックス問題」とガバナンスの必要性

AI技術の進化は、単なるテキスト生成から「自律的なタスク実行」へとパラダイムシフトを起こしています。それがAIエージェントです。しかし、この革新的な技術をエンタープライズ環境に導入しようとする際、多くの組織が「信頼性の壁」に直面します。技術的な可能性がどれほど高くても、ガバナンスが欠如したシステムをビジネスの基幹業務に組み込むことは不可能です。

自律型エージェント特有のリスク:予測不可能性と連鎖的エラー

従来のLLM(大規模言語モデル)を活用したチャットボットは、ユーザーの入力に対して一度だけ応答を返す「一問一答型」のシステムでした。仮に誤った回答(ハルシネーション)が発生したとしても、その影響は画面上のテキストにとどまり、ユーザー自身がその誤りを認識して無視することができました。

一方で、AIエージェントは自ら目標達成のための計画を立て、外部のツール(APIやデータベース)を呼び出し、その結果をもとに次の行動を決定します。例えば、「顧客データを検索し、該当する請求書を生成してメールで送信する」といった一連のワークフローを自律的に実行することが可能です。この自律性こそが、エンタープライズにおける最大のリスクとなります。

AIエージェントが誤った判断を下した場合、そのエラーは単なる「不適切な回答」では済まされません。誤った顧客へのメール送信、データベースの意図しない書き換え、あるいはエラーを自己修復しようとして陥る無限ループによるAPIコストの暴騰など、ビジネスに直結する深刻なインシデントを引き起こす可能性があります。自律的に動くシステムにおいて、「なぜそのツールを選択したのか」「どのような推論プロセスを経てその結論に至ったのか」がブラックボックス化することは、ガバナンスの観点から絶対に避けなければなりません。

「なんとなく動く」から「確実な統制」へのパラダイムシフト

PoC(概念実証)の段階では、AIエージェントが「なんとなく意図通りに動く」ことで成功とみなされがちです。開発環境での限られたテストデータに対しては、完璧に動作するように見えるかもしれません。しかし、実運用(プロダクション)環境に移行した途端、ユーザーからの予期せぬ入力、APIのレイテンシ増加、LLMのプロバイダー側でのサイレントなモデルアップデートに伴う精度の劣化など、様々な課題が表面化します。

企業がAIエージェントを安全に運用するためには、システム全体の挙動を継続的に監視し、定量的に評価し、異常を即座に制御するための強固なガバナンス基盤が不可欠です。これを実現するためのアプローチが「AgentOps(Agent Operations)」です。AgentOpsは、AIエージェントのライフサイクル全体(開発、テスト、デプロイ、監視)を管理するための新しい実践体系であり、これを支える専用の評価・ガバナンスツールの導入が、今後のAI戦略における最重要課題となります。

AIエージェント評価の4大指標:選定前に定義すべき「品質」の正体

ガバナンスツールを選定する前に、まずは「何を評価すべきか」を明確にする必要があります。従来の自然言語処理で用いられてきたROUGEやBLEUといった単語の重なりを見る評価指標は、自律的に行動するAIエージェントの評価には適していません。現在、業界標準となりつつあるのは、高性能なLLM自身を評価者として用いる「LLM-as-a-Judge」のアプローチを取り入れた、より多角的な評価フレームワークです。実務的な観点から、以下の4つの指標を定義することが推奨されます。

1. 忠実性(Faithfulness)と事実性(Factuality)

AIエージェントが生成する出力が、提供されたコンテキスト(RAGにおける検索結果や社内ドキュメントなど)に忠実であるか、そして事実に基づいているかを評価します。エージェントが外部情報を取得した際、その情報を無視して独自の事前学習データで回答を捏造(ハルシネーション)していないかを確認することは、ビジネス利用において極めて重要です。

この評価では、検索されたコンテキストと最終的な生成回答の間の論理的な整合性を、別のLLMを用いてスコアリングする手法が一般的です。また、回答の根拠となる情報源(引用元)が正確に示されているかどうかも、信頼性を担保するための重要なチェック項目となります。

2. ツール利用の正確性(Tool Call Accuracy)

AIエージェントの核となる能力が、外部ツールの呼び出し(Tool Calling)です。ここでは以下の点が厳密に評価対象となります。

  • ツールの選択精度: ユーザーの意図に対して、適切なAPIや関数を選択できているか。
  • 引数の妥当性: ツールに渡す引数(パラメータ)のデータ型やフォーマット、値が正確か(例:日付フォーマットのパースミスがないか)。
  • 実行順序の論理性: 複数ステップにわたるツールの実行順序が正しいか(例:データを検索する前に認証APIを通過しているか)。

データベース検索ツールに渡すSQLクエリの構文が間違っていれば、エージェントのタスクは失敗します。ツール実行の成功率や、エラー発生時の自己修復(エラーメッセージを読み取り、プロンプトを修正してリトライする能力)を定量的に測定することが求められます。

3. ガードレール遵守と安全性(Safety & Compliance)

エンタープライズ環境では、コンプライアンスの遵守が絶対条件です。AIエージェントが企業のポリシーや倫理基準に違反しないよう、入出力の両面でガードレールを設ける必要があります。

  • 入力の安全性: ユーザーからの悪意ある入力(プロンプトインジェクションやジェイルブレイク攻撃)を検知し、エージェントが不正な操作を強制されることを防いでいるか。
  • 出力の安全性: 出力結果にPII(個人を特定できる情報)や機密情報が含まれていないか。また、差別的、暴力的なコンテンツを生成していないか。

これらの安全性指標は、システムを本番環境に公開する前に、レッドチーミング(意図的にシステムを攻撃して脆弱性を探るセキュリティテスト)を通じて徹底的に評価されるべき項目です。

4. 運用コストとレイテンシの最適化

AIエージェントは、1つのタスクを完了するまでに複数回のLLM呼び出し(推論サイクル)を行うため、従来のシステムと比較してコストと応答時間(レイテンシ)が肥大化しやすい傾向があります。

  • トークン消費の効率性: タスク完了までの総消費トークン数が予算内に収まっているか。
  • 処理時間の監視: 各ステップのAPI呼び出しにかかる時間や、ユーザーへの初回応答時間(Time to First Token)は適切か。
  • 推論の冗長性排除: 無駄なループや冗長な推論プロセスが発生していないかを分析する。

これらを継続的にモニタリングし、最適化のボトルネックを特定することは、長期的な運用コストを適正に保つために不可欠です。

主要AgentOps・ガバナンスツールの徹底比較分析

AIエージェント評価の4大指標:選定前に定義すべき「品質」の正体 - Section Image

AIエージェントの評価とガバナンスを実現するため、市場には様々なツールが登場しています。ここでは、代表的なプラットフォームのアプローチと特徴を客観的な視点から比較分析します。

LangSmith (LangChain):開発密着型のデバッグ・評価基盤

LangChainエコシステムの一部として提供されているLangSmithは、LLMアプリケーションの観測・評価・開発に特化したプラットフォームです。公式ドキュメントによると、LangChainやLangGraphで構築されたエージェントの実行ログをシームレスに収集できる点が最大の特徴です。

  • トレーシング機能:エージェントが実行した一連のステップ(プロンプトの生成、ツール呼び出し、APIレスポンス)をツリー状に可視化し、複雑なステートフルワークフローの中で、どこでエラーや遅延が発生したかを直感的に特定できます。
  • 評価機能:LLMベース、ルールベース、人手による評価を組み合わせた品質評価パイプラインを構築可能であり、プロンプトの変更がエージェントの精度にどう影響するかを定量的に比較できます。
  • データセット管理:テスト用の入力データと期待される出力(ゴールデンデータセット)を管理し、継続的なCI/CDパイプラインに組み込むことが想定されています。

開発初期のデバッグから本番環境のモニタリングまで、LangChainベースのプロジェクトにおいて最も導入障壁が低い選択肢と言えます。

MLOpsプラットフォームの拡張:実験管理から実運用監視へ

機械学習分野(MLOps)の実験管理ツールとして広く知られるプラットフォーム(例えばWeights & Biasesなど)は、LLM向けの機能拡張を通じてAgentOps領域にも対応し始めています。
従来の機械学習モデルのトレーニング(例えばHugging Faceエコシステムで提供されるLoRAなどのパラメータ効率の良い微調整手法)におけるハイパーパラメータの追跡やモデルのバージョン管理で培った堅牢な基盤を活かし、プロンプトエンジニアリングの実験結果を体系的に管理するアプローチをとっています。
既存のMLOpsパイプラインをすでに構築している組織にとっては、従来の機械学習プロジェクトとLLMベースのプロジェクトを一元管理できるという運用上のメリットが期待できます。

オープンソースによるオブザーバビリティの追求

オープンソースのオブザーバビリティツール(Arize Phoenixなどに代表されるアプローチ)は、ベンダーロックインを避けたい企業や、データを外部に出せない厳格なセキュリティ要件を持つ組織から注目を集めています。
ローカル環境や自社VPC内にデプロイ可能でありながら、LLMのトレース可視化や、埋め込み(Embedding)ベクトルのクラスタリング分析など、高度なトラブルシューティング機能を提供します。RAGシステムにおける検索精度の低下原因を視覚的に特定するなど、データサイエンスの視点からエージェントの挙動を深く分析する用途に適しています。

エンタープライズ向けの堅牢なガードレールと監視

データ品質とセキュリティ監視に特化したプラットフォーム(WhyLabsやLangKitのアプローチなど)は、入力されるプロンプトや出力されるテキストの「安全性」に焦点を当てています。
テキストの毒性(Toxicity)、センチメント、機密情報の有無などをリアルタイムでスコアリングし、異常値が検出された場合には即座にアラートを発砲したり、システムを遮断したりするガードレール機能を提供します。金融機関や医療機関など、コンプライアンス要件が極めて厳しい業界において、実運用時のリスクを最小限に抑えるための「最後の砦」として機能します。

【機能・コスト・信頼性】比較マトリクスによる定量評価

主要AgentOps・ガバナンスツールの徹底比較分析 - Section Image

ガバナンスツールを選定する際は、自社の要件に合わせた定量的な評価が必要です。検討時に確認すべき主要な評価軸を整理します。

機能比較:トレース、評価、ガードレール、データセキュリティ

ツールによって設計思想と得意とする領域が大きく異なります。

  1. 開発・デバッグ支援:複雑なエージェントの推論プロセスを可視化するトレーシング機能は、LangSmithのような開発フレームワークと密接に統合されたツールが圧倒的な優位性を持ちます。開発者の生産性向上に直結する機能です。
  2. 自動評価パイプライン:データセットのバージョン管理とLLM-as-a-Judgeによる自動スコアリング機能は、継続的なプロンプト改善(CI/CD)に必須です。評価のカスタマイズ性が高いツールを選ぶ必要があります。
  3. リアルタイム・ガードレール:本番環境での異常検知や入力フィルタリングは、専用のセキュリティ監視ツールの導入を検討すべき領域です。エージェントの処理をブロックする際のレイテンシ(遅延)への影響も考慮する必要があります。

コスト構造の分析:従量課金 vs ユーザー課金の損益分岐点

ツールの料金体系は、大きく分けて「トレースされるデータ量(スパン数やトークン数)に基づく従量課金」と「利用する開発者の数に基づくユーザー課金(またはシート課金)」に分かれます。最新の料金体系は各公式サイトで確認する必要がありますが、一般的な傾向として以下の点に注意が必要です。

PoC段階では、初期費用が抑えられる従量課金モデルが好まれます。しかし、本番環境で大量のトラフィックを処理するようになると、ログの保存やデータ転送にかかる隠れコストが急増する可能性があります。トラフィックの予測に基づき、適切なサンプリングレート(全ログではなく、例えば10%のログのみを記録する設定)を適用できるかどうかも、エンタープライズ規模での重要な選定基準となります。

サポート・SLA・エンタープライズ対応状況

エンタープライズ企業がSaaS型のガバナンスツールを導入する際、機能以上に重要になるのがセキュリティ認証とSLA(サービス品質保証)です。

  • セキュリティ認証: SOC2 Type II認証やISO27001などの国際的なセキュリティ基準を満たしているか。
  • データプライバシー: 企業内の機密データや個人情報を含むログをプラットフォームに送信する際、ベンダー側でのAI学習への利用をオプトアウト(拒否)できることが明示的に保証されているか。
  • デプロイメントオプション: データレジデンシー(データ保存地域)の要件を満たすための特定リージョンでのホスティングや、オンプレミス/VPC内へのデプロイオプションが提供されているか。

これらの要件を満たせない場合、どんなに優れた機能を持つツールであっても、企業のセキュリティ部門の審査を通過することは困難です。選定の初期段階で必ず確認すべき項目です。

選定シナリオ別:自社に最適なガバナンスツールはどれか?

選定シナリオ別:自社に最適なガバナンスツールはどれか? - Section Image 3

「どのツールが最も優れているか」という問いに、単一の正解はありません。自社の開発体制、ビジネス要件、そしてセキュリティ基準に応じて、最適な選択肢は異なります。以下に代表的な選定シナリオを提示します。

シナリオA:開発スピードを最優先し、LangChainエコシステムを活用する場合

対象読者:アジャイルな開発チーム、スタートアップ、新規事業開発部門
推奨アプローチ:LangSmithなどの開発フレームワーク統合型ツールの採用

すでにLangChainやLangGraphを用いてAIエージェントのプロトタイプを構築している場合、最も摩擦なく導入できるのがこのシナリオです。ソースコードに数行の環境変数を追加するだけで、エージェントの全挙動が可視化されるため、開発者のデバッグ効率が飛躍的に向上します。インフラ構築の手間を省き、まずはPoCを迅速に回して社内での価値実証を急ぎたい組織に最適です。

シナリオB:金融・医療など、高度なセキュリティとガードレールが必須の場合

対象読者:エンタープライズアーキテクト、セキュリティ担当役員、コンプライアンス部門
推奨アプローチ:セルフホスト可能なオープンソースツール、またはエンタープライズ向けガードレール専用ツールの導入

顧客の個人情報や機密性の高い社内データを扱う場合、外部のSaaSプラットフォームにログを送信すること自体が重大なリスクとなります。このようなケースでは、自社VPC内にデプロイ可能な監視インフラを構築し、入力と出力の双方に厳格なルールベースおよびAIベースのガードレールを設けるアプローチが求められます。開発の俊敏性は多少犠牲になるかもしれませんが、インシデント発生時のビジネスリスクを最小化するための必須の投資と言えます。

シナリオC:既存のMLOps環境との統合・共通化を重視する場合

対象読者:データサイエンスチーム、AIプロダクトマネージャー、大規模な開発組織
推奨アプローチ:既存のMLOpsプラットフォームのLLM向け拡張機能の活用

すでに社内で機械学習モデルの運用基盤(MLOps)が確立されている場合、AIエージェントのためだけに新しいサイロ化されたツールを導入することは、運用コストと学習コストの増加を招きます。既存の実験管理ツールやモデル監視プラットフォームが提供するLLMOps/AgentOps機能を活用することで、従来の機械学習モデルとLLMベースのエージェントを一元的に管理・監視する体制を構築することが推奨されます。これにより、データサイエンティストとソフトウェアエンジニア間のコラボレーションも促進されます。

失敗しないための導入チェックリストと次の一手

AIエージェントのガバナンスツールは、導入すれば自動的にシステムが安全になる「魔法の杖」ではありません。ツールを効果的に活用し、組織的な統制を効かせるための運用設計が不可欠です。最後に、実践に向けた具体的なアクションを整理します。

PoCから本番環境への移行で陥りやすい3つの罠

  1. 評価基準の曖昧さ:「なんとなく良さそうな回答が出た」という主観的な評価で本番移行を決定してしまうケースは非常に危険です。必ず事前に、前述の4大指標に基づく定量的な評価指標(KPI)を関係者間で合意しておく必要があります。
  2. ログの放置と監視の形骸化:トレースツールを導入したものの、重大なエラーが発生した時しかダッシュボードを見ない運用になりがちです。継続的なモニタリングと、AIガバナンス委員会等による定期的なレビューのプロセスを業務フローに組み込むことが重要です。
  3. 過度なガードレールによるUX低下:セキュリティを重視するあまり、エージェントの回答が保守的になりすぎたり、フィルタリング処理によって応答時間が長くなりすぎたりして、ユーザーが離脱してしまう罠です。安全性と利便性のトレードオフを意識し、バランスを継続的にチューニングする必要があります。

評価用ゴールデンデータセットの構築ステップ

強固なガバナンスの基盤となるのは「質の高い評価データ」です。ツール選定と並行して明日から着手すべき最初のアクションは、このゴールデンデータセットの構築です。

  • ステップ1:実際の業務で想定される代表的なユースケース(ユーザーからの質問と、エージェントに期待されるアクション・ツール呼び出し)を数十件リストアップし、正解データを作成する。
  • ステップ2:エッジケースや、システムに意図的に失敗させようとする悪意のある入力(レッドチーム用データ)を含め、システムの堅牢性をテストできる状態にする。
  • ステップ3:実運用開始後は、定期的に本番環境のログから新しいパターン(ユーザーの予期せぬ使い方)を抽出し、データセットを継続的にアップデートする運用サイクルを回す。

確実な一歩を踏み出すために

自律的に動作するAIエージェントの振る舞いを完全に、そして100%制御することは現在の技術では困難かもしれません。しかし、適切なガバナンスツールを導入することで、その挙動を「観測可能」かつ「評価可能」な状態にし、リスクを許容範囲内に収めることは十分に可能です。

自社への適用を検討する際は、まずは課題に最も適したツールの無料デモやトライアル環境を活用し、実際のプロンプトやエージェントの挙動がどのようにダッシュボード上で可視化されるのかを体感してみることをおすすめします。サンドボックス環境での小さな検証から始めることで、導入に伴う技術的リスクを最小限に抑えつつ、自律型AIの真のポテンシャルを引き出すための運用ノウハウを確実に蓄積することができるでしょう。

参考リンク

自律型AIの信頼性を担保するAgentOps実践アプローチ:ガバナンス・評価ツール比較と導入検討ガイド - Conclusion Image

参考文献

  1. https://dev.classmethod.jp/articles/bedrock-mantle-anthropic-endpoint-opus-4-7/
  2. https://aws.amazon.com/jp/blogs/news/valkey-turns-two/
  3. https://www.itmedia.co.jp/author/261767/
  4. https://learn.microsoft.com/ja-jp/azure/container-apps/sessions-code-interpreter
  5. https://cloud.google.com/blog/ja/topics/google-cloud-next/google-cloud-next-2026-wrap-up
  6. https://prtimes.jp/main/html/rd/p/000000123.000038634.html
  7. https://www.trifields.jp/pypi-science-and-technology-2-6054

コメント

コメントは1週間で消えます
コメントを読み込み中...